Yes it’s in Ventnor and referred to as the Cascade. Last week there was such torrential rain the waterfall couldn’t cope and rainwater flooded under the road causing major cracks and damage. Poor Ventnor is prone to landslips and damage like this in their much needed tourist season will be a huge blow. ☹️
